About The Position

The Maintenance Repairer 2 will perform skilled work involving the assembly, repair, and maintenance of agency buildings, facilities, and equipment. This position assists with preventative maintenance activities and ensures compliance with agency policies, procedures, regulations, and safety standards while performing assigned duties. The Office of Management and Finance (OMF) oversees the agency’s fiscal operations, budgeting, procurement and contracts, human resources, and other key administrative functions. We provide the internal support and oversight needed to ensure efficient, accountable, and transparent agency operations. OMF does not deliver direct services to the public.

Requirements

  • Two years of experience or training in the building construction trades, building maintenance, maintenance or repair of mechanical equipment, or park operations and grounds maintenance; OR Completion of a two-year vocational technical program in general building construction, construction technology, or engineering; OR Twelve semester hours in construction management, construction technology, or engineering, or any combination of these courses.

Responsibilities

  • Performs assigned tasks in the preventative maintenance program in the Baton Rouge area and area offices located statewide.
  • Servicing, repairing and replacing mechanical equipment such as pumps, chiller, A/C system, air handling units, hot water heaters, steam coils, traps and all other HVAC systems and equipment.
  • Performs electrical installation and repairs within the agency buildings (receptacles, breaker panels, lights, ballasts, coax and IBM cables, MCC cables, and other electrical items.
  • Performs plumbing duties. Installs, alters, maintains, and repairs water lines, fixtures, commodes, sinks, urinals, valves, make-up tanks, chill water lines, etc.
  • Performs task related to door hardware, door locks and cubical locks. Maintains the key stock and lock stock.
  • Performs painting tasks such as preparing surfaces to be painted and painting those surfaces, such as brick walls. Sheet-rock walls, equipment, etc.
  • Works with Telephone, Electronic Tech as needed.
  • Maintains supplies, tools, and equipment in agency stock.
  • Performs other related duties as assigned or required by the supervisor.
